Switching the unidirectional printing mode on/ off

ESC
27
1B
Function:
Normally printing is bidirectional (optimal printing path). Unidirectional printing
(printing in only one direction) is sensible, for example, in order to ensure a pre-
cise positioning of the characters when printing a text or graphics, thus to produ-
ce a neat print format.
ESC U (n) activates or deactivates unidirectional printing, by which n serves as
an on/ off switch:
n = 1
activates the mode (unidirectional on),
n = 0
deactivates the mode (unidirectional off).
Example:
After printing three lines, a change is to take place between bidirectional and uni-
directional printing. Bidirectional printing begins.
